2009 Ontario Hockey Federation Bantam A Championships
Hespeler Minor Hockey All Set to Host All Ontario Finals
Saturday, April 11th, 2009
A great weekend of Championship minor hockey is set for April 10-12th in Cambridge. Hespeler Minor Hockey Association (HMHA) will play host to the 2009 Ontario Hockey Federation Bantam A Championships. Champions from the 4 member groups of the OHF: The Ontario Minor Hockey Association (OMHA), The Greater Toronto Hockey League (GTHL), The Northern Ontario Hockey Association (NOHA)and The Minor Hockey Alliance of Ontario (MHAO) as well as the host Hespeler Shamrocks will faceoff at Hespeler Memorial Arena in a round robin finals tournament.
The weekend will begin with a banquet Thursday night for players, team officials, and league and OHF dignitaries and wraps up Sunday with the awarding of the OHF Championship trophy.
The Ontario Hockey Federation is a Branch of Hockey Canada which is the self-governing body of all amateur hockey in Canada. As the largest of the 13 Branches of Hockey Canada, the OHF has jurisdiction over most of the province of Ontario. There are over 185,000 players playing on more than 11,000 registered teams and over 25,000 coaches, trainers and officials who make hockey programs possible within the Federation.
Hespeler Minor Hockey Association administers the hockey program within Hespeler for 820 children annually offering representative A and AE hockey as well as house league from ages 5-18.
